About Wells Enterprises, Inc.
Wells Enterprises manufactures ice cream and frozen novelties sold nationwide through grocery, convenience and club stores, foodservice channels, and mobile vendors, primarily under the Blue Bunny and Bomb Pop brands. Founded in 1913 and headquartered in Le Mars, Iowa, it operates multiple plants across the U.S. and is an independent operating company of the Ferrero Group, recognized as the largest privately held ice cream maker in the United States.
